LISA LOUISE OTTENWELLER, 65, of New Haven, passed away on Wednesday, June 20, 2018. Mc Donald's lost a loyal customer for she was an avid coffee drinker and rarely seen without her McDon-ald's styrofoam cup. A legend in the Parkview Emergency Room, Lisa was a trauma nurse for 40 years who was...
